
Cannabis 101 by Daniel Ulloa
Cannabis 101 focuses on the history, uses, and controversies of cannabis. While cultivated throughout history, only in the last 100 years was cannabis demonized for political gains. It is being restored to its place within society as a medicine and as a recreational substance less harmful than beer.
The book presents a comprehensive overview of cannabis legalization and the industry it birthed. The process by which activists and ambitious entrepreneurs developed a multi-billion-dollar industry across the United States is chronicled along with remaining issues and the fallout from the War on Drugs. The book delves into cannabis history, medical benefits of the plant, the many uses of hemp, and the nature of the industry creating the Green Rush.
The author interviewed national advocates and industry leaders to reveal this turning point in history and what some call a once in a lifetime opportunity.
